在当今快速发展的科技行业中,软件测试作为保障产品质量的重要环节,其重要性日益凸显。那么,从事软件测试工作的专业人士,他们的薪资水平如何呢?本文将从多个角度为您详细解读。
行业背景与需求
随着互联网技术的普及和数字化转型的加速,软件开发已成为企业竞争力的核心之一。然而,高质量的软件产品离不开有效的测试流程。软件测试不仅能够发现潜在的问题,还能帮助企业优化用户体验,提升品牌价值。因此,软件测试工程师的需求量逐年攀升。
工资水平的影响因素
软件测试工程师的薪资水平受多种因素影响,主要包括以下几点:
1. 工作经验
初入行的软件测试工程师由于经验有限,薪资通常处于较低水平。但随着工作经验的积累,特别是在自动化测试、性能测试等领域取得专业认证后,薪资会有显著提升。
2. 技能水平
掌握主流编程语言(如Python、Java)以及自动化测试工具(如Selenium、JMeter)的工程师,往往能获得更高的薪资待遇。此外,具备数据分析能力或熟悉敏捷开发流程的测试人员也更受欢迎。
3. 行业差异
不同行业的软件测试工程师薪资存在差异。例如,在金融、医疗等高附加值行业工作的测试人员,其薪资水平普遍高于传统制造业。
4. 地域差异
在一线城市(如北京、上海、深圳),由于生活成本较高,软件测试工程师的平均薪资水平也相对较高。而在二三线城市,虽然竞争压力较小,但薪资水平也会相应降低。
具体薪资范围
根据市场调研数据,国内软件测试工程师的月薪大致分布在以下区间:
- 初级测试工程师:5,000元 - 8,000元
- 中级测试工程师:8,000元 - 15,000元
- 高级测试工程师:15,000元 - 25,000元
- 资深测试经理/架构师:25,000元以上
需要注意的是,上述数据仅为参考值,实际薪资还需结合个人能力和公司规模等因素综合考量。
发展前景与建议
对于有志于从事软件测试领域的求职者来说,未来发展前景十分广阔。一方面,随着人工智能、大数据等新兴技术的应用,软件测试领域将迎来更多创新机会;另一方面,企业对高质量人才的需求也在不断增加。
为了提高自身竞争力,建议从业者不断学习新知识、掌握新技术,并积极参与行业交流活动,拓展人脉资源。同时,可以考虑考取相关的职业资格证书,为职业发展增添砝码。
总结
软件测试工程师的薪资水平因人而异,但整体来看,这是一个具有较高成长潜力的职业方向。无论是初学者还是资深从业者,只要保持持续学习的态度,就能在这个领域中找到属于自己的舞台。希望本文能为您的职业规划提供一些有价值的参考!